To calibrate a cartridge, start by ensuring the device is turned off. Gently insert the cartridge, then turn the device on. Follow specific calibration instructions in the device's manual, which usually involves running a series of test prints or adjustments via the settings menu to achieve accurate alignment and performance.

  1. Why is cartridge calibration important? Cartridge calibration ensures accurate alignment and optimal performance of your device, preventing printing errors and equipment malfunctions.
  2. How often should I calibrate my cartridge? You should calibrate your cartridge whenever you install a new one or notice performance issues to maintain consistent device accuracy.
  3. What are common steps in calibrating a cartridge? Common steps include turning off the device, inserting the cartridge properly, turning the device on, and following on-screen instructions or manual guidelines to run test prints or adjustments.
